The Hon. Artillery Company's Ball: the Princess of Wales's Boudoir, 1870. 'The ball given by the Hon. Artillery Company of London, in honour of the Prince and Princess of Wales, on Wednesday week, was a splendid entertainment. The Armoury House...was fitted up and decorated for this festive occasion...The old guard-room had been transformed into a boudoir for the special use of the Princess of Wales [future Queen Alexandra], on the same floor with the ball-room. It was splendidly furnished, and the walls were hung with drapery; an Aubusson carpet covered the floor; a handsome white marble chimneypiece and steel stove hid the ancient fireplace...At the entrance to her boudoir the Princess of Wales was received by seven ladies, wives of officers of the company'. From "Illustrated London News", 1870.
